<p>The Asian College of Journalism (ACJ) in Chennai offers various journalism programs with different fee structures. The total tuition fees for the PG Diploma in Journalism programme at ACJ range from INR 4,60,200 to INR 7,08,000, depending on the specific program. The fees are payable in two equal installments. Additionally, there are costs for residential accommodation and food expenses for students who opt for these facilities. The fees are considered relatively expensive for a one-year course.</p>

<p>The highest package offered at the Asian College of Journalism was INR 8.6 LPA (Lakhs Per Annum). The top recruiters at Asian College of Journalism (ACJ) include companies such as Bloomberg News, YourStory, The Economic Times, The Indian Express, Times Now, ETNow, and CNN-News 18,&nbsp;The Hindu, The Times Group, Republic, and many more. Positions are offered to students based on how well they do in the interviews and placement tests. Sharpening your skills might increase your pay scale.</p><p>&nbsp;</p><p>&nbsp;</p>

<p>Apeejay School of Management offers admissions to its PGDM programme on an entrance-basis. The institute accepts various national-level management entrance exams, such as CAT/ XAT/ ATMA/ MAT, etc. Hence, yes, you can join the PGDM programme offered at Apeejay School of Management without appearing for CAT. However, you must appear for any of the other accepted entrance exams. For further admission related details, contact the help desk of the institute.</p>

You will get the list of documents on the JEE Mains counselling portal. Mainly, you need to bring your admit card and score card of JEE Mains, mark sheets of class 12th and class 10th, domicile certificate, income certificate, category certificates, government id card etc. Best of luck.
